The Blues will be without defenseman Jay McKee for at least two weeks after a knee-to-knee hit in Thursday's 5-2 loss to Minnesota. McKee suffered a sprained right knee when he collided with Minnesota left winger Derek Boogaard with five minutes remaining in the game. McKee was holding the puck in the Blues' zone and trying to make a play up the middle, he said. "I saw (Boogaard) coming the whole way ... I thought it would be a routine bump off the wall," McKee said. "But he went right into my knee."
